Course Description:

1. An intensive look at God’s mandate for missions which is a prevailing theme from the beginning of God’s Word, in the OT, and its fulfilment in the NT era up to the present day.


2. We will look into developments in the missionary task—strategies, terminologies and also take heed of its urgent call for all Christians to participate.

Course Objectives
At the end of the course, YOU (students) will learn:
A- The Theology of Mission—
1. Discover in the OT, God’s MISSIONARY MESSAGE to the GENTILES and the NATIONS of the world;
2. God’s MISSIONARY PURPOSE in the NEW TESTAMENT era and beyond
B- The ADVANCEMENT of the GOSPEL from BIBLICAL TIMES to the PRESENT time;
C- The IMPORTANCE and NATURE of STRATEGIES in WORLD EVANGELIZATION;
D- The MISSIONARY TASK at hand—who and where the majority of the UNREACHED people groups are and consider METHODS that can be used to REACH them;
E- The DYNAMICS of CULTURE and how to ADDRESS ISSUES for effective inter-cultural INTERACTION;
F- That ALL are CALLED to take a VITAL PART in mission—students will discover their God-given role in mission by studying the 6 Ways of reaching God’s world.
